Some people buy organic chocolate because they want to avoid the consequences of conventional farming. Organic foods are produced without the use of genetically modified organisms, pesticides and other toxic chemicals. Some people buy organic chocolate because they believe that organic foods are healthier.

Dagoba chocolate founded by Frederick Schilling in 2001 is a premium brand of organic chocolate. A Dagoba chocolate bar is guaranteed to be 95% organic.
